The Data Center Fire Detection and Suppression Market was valued at USD 1.2 billion in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 2.4 billion by 2033,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 8.7% from 2025 to 2033. This growth is driven by the exponential expansion of data center infrastructure worldwide, increasing regulatory compliance requirements, and the adoption of advanced, industry-specific fire safety solutions. As data centers become more critical to global digital economies, investments in reliable fire detection and suppression systems are escalating to mitigate operational risks and ensure business continuity. The rising complexity of data center architectures and the proliferation of edge computing further fuel demand for innovative fire safety technologies. Strategic market penetration and technological advancements are expected to sustain this upward trajectory through the forecast period.
The Data Center Fire Detection and Suppression Market encompasses the development, deployment, and management of specialized fire safety systems designed specifically for data centers. These systems include advanced fire detection sensors, intelligent alarm systems, and suppression technologies such as gas-based, waterless, and foam suppression solutions tailored to protect sensitive electronic equipment. The market is driven by the need to prevent catastrophic data loss, minimize downtime, and comply with stringent safety regulations. As data centers house critical infrastructure, the market emphasizes innovative, scalable, and environmentally sustainable fire safety solutions that integrate seamlessly with modern data center operations. The focus is on delivering rapid detection, precise localization, and effective suppression to ensure operational resilience.

Despite robust growth prospects, the market faces several restraints. High initial capital expenditure for deploying advanced fire detection and suppression systems can be prohibitive, especially for smaller data centers. Compatibility issues with existing infrastructure and the complexity of integrating new systems pose implementation challenges. Regulatory compliance varies across regions, creating a fragmented landscape that complicates standardization efforts. Additionally, concerns regarding the environmental impact of certain suppression agents, such as halons, limit adoption. The rapid technological evolution also risks obsolescence of installed systems, necessitating ongoing upgrades and maintenance. These factors collectively temper the pace of market expansion and demand strategic mitigation approaches.
